Judaism and Environmentalism

What does the story of Creation have to teach us about our relationship with the earth? What obligations do we have toward nature? What do Torah and our liturgy teach us about climate change? Come explore these questions - and more! - In person, with Reb Nikki on Tuesday evenings.
